Grape varieties

100% Furmint

Terroirs

Clay and rhyolite soils, Tolcsva region, Mandolas vineyard, vines averaging 25 years old, a selection from a plot over 50 years old, hillsides located at an altitude of 150 to 300 meters

Viticulture

Reasoned

Grape Harvest

Manuals

Winemaking

Selection of specific vineyard plots, gentle pressing to obtain a high-density must, fermentation in new Hungarian oak barrels (20%) and temperature-controlled stainless steel tanks (80%) for 8 to 12 days

Livestock farming

Aged for 3 months in 136-liter Hungarian oak barrels with weekly stirring, followed by an additional 3 months, then 1 year in bottles

Alcohol content

13%

Eye

Straw-colored, with silvery highlights, clear and bright

Nose

Very fresh on the nose, with subtle citrus notes and seductive floral aromas

Palate

A smooth, fresh attack, lovely richness, expressive flavors of stone fruit and citrus, hints of white flowers, and vibrant, invigorating acidity that carries through to a finish with lovely length

Serve

At 10-12°C

Open

1 hour before

Drink from

2024

Drink before

2035

Food and wine pairings

Food and wine pairings

Pair with a cod fillet served with fennel and celery, or a tartare of marinated and lightly smoked trout with a beet salad (a culinary recommendation from the Oremus estate)
